FRANKFURT — British stunt driver Terry Grant raced into the record books in Jaguar's new F-PACE sports vehicle after performing the largest loop the loop in a car at Germany's Niederrad Racecourse on Monday.

After two months of preparation to make sure his body was ready to withstand the severe G-Force, Grant completed the 62 feet tall, 360 degree circle, according to Guinness World Records.

Grant said making sure he hit the correct speed — of about 55 mph —was critical to complete the loop.
